A Bamboo Carbon Filter for Diesels Could Reduce Emissions

Cars That Think

Although the pollutant emissions of a diesel engine are less than those of a gasoline one, it still emits carcinogens, nitrous oxides, and soot. Older models don’t even have the emission-control features that newer ones do. To reduce emissions, diesel vehicles use filters that catch exhaust particles and other contaminants.

Axial Vector and Kirloskar Oil Engines Forming JV for Mass Production of Axial-Type Engines

Green Car Congress

Intake and exhaust valves open and close by a patent-pending method of rotating cam and trunions. The AVEC engines can use multiple fuel types, including diesel, JP5 and JP8 military fuels, kerosene, bio-diesels, ethanol, and other blends of these fuels, with a special conversion kit available for the combustion of natural gas or propane.
